INSTALLATION AND OPERATION MANUAL Electronic pressure switch with protection against dry running ZD 15 Please read these manuals carefully before installation and application of the device Both the installer and the end user must respect the manuals in detail also concerning the valid local regulations rules and laws The device complies with the valid regulations the EU The manufacturer assumes no liability for damages resulting from an incorrect application or an application under conditions different from those indicated on the type plate or within this manual Cut off the power supply before opening the cover if you want to remove the device or the switching cabinet RANGE OF APPLICATION AND SERVICES Device for automatic control of electronic pumps in water units e Replaces the traditional system with expansion tank id Switches the pump on or off depending on opening or closing of the extraction points e Keeps the pressure constant during the extraction e Switches the pump off is case of water deficiency and ensures a protection against dry running e Prevents hydraulic shock effects e Requires no maintenance TECHNICAL DATA Voltage single phase 230 V Protection class IP 55 Permissible voltage fluctuations 10 Device ZD 15 Frequency 50 60 Hz Maximum operating pressure 8 bar 0 8 MPa Current rating 16 6 A Maximum operating temperature 65 Maximum output 1 1 kW 1 5 HP External thread G1 AG Non adjustable standa
2. should be connected to the pump using a flexible hose fig 1 B Before commissioning the device make sure the pump is properly bled POWER CONNECTION fig 4 The device may be connected to mains by qualified staff only and in accordance with the valid legal requirements An all phase switch with a terminal distance of minimum 3 mm must always be connected head of the device One phase pumps 230 V with a motor output of up to 1 1 kW 1 5 HP fig 4 A may be connected directly to the device while one phase pumps with an output of more than 1 1 kW 1 5 HP fig 4 B must connected via a contactor to the device Check the mains voltage at the data indicated on the type plate of the pump motor e Connect the electrical power as indicated in the graphs of fig 4 e Use cables of type HOS or HO7 with a cross section of 3x1 mm2 e Make sure the device is connected to the earthing system COMMISSIONING AND OPERATION fig 3 The green lamp power on on the front side of the device shows that voltage is connected while the yellow lamp pump on shows that the pump in operation If the device will be connected to the mains the green and the yellow lamp light up The latter shows that the pump is started fig 3 A it rests in operation for some seconds in order that the unit may be pressured If this time should not suffice push and hold the red button restart and wait until water leaves from an opened extraction point After clos
3. ing the extraction point the device deactivated the pump and rests in stand by mode in doing so the green lamp remains switched on and the device is ready to execute all further command and control processes completely independent fig 3 B When opening an extraction point the device activates the pump it rests in operation until the extraction point is closed again fig 3 A After closing the extraction point the device recovers the maximum pressure in the unit switches the pump off and changes again to stand by mode fig 3 B If there is a water deficiency during the intake process the device switches the pump fig 3 C off in order to protect it against dry running As soon as the disturbance which caused the blockage is removed it is sufficient to push the red restart button in order to retake the normal operation In case of a temporary disturbance of the power supply the device starts again automatically as soon as the power is reconnected DISTURBANCES CHIEF CAUSE e The pump does not start Faulty power supply e The pump does not switch on The water column is too high e The pump operates with disruptions Water removal of the unit is lower than the minimum flow e The pump does not switch off Loss of water in the unit is higher than the minimum flow e The pump is blocked Intake difficulties A defective switching cabinet may be replaced without removal of the device The switching cabinet is replaceable and can be del
4. ivered on request Further disturbances and causes different to the above mentioned may be prevented or removed by carefully checking the characteristics of the device the pump and the unit considering the instructions in the section on installation FIGURES N P min 3 5 bar SS ee EV Attention roar fa The pressure switch may only moot CE goreesl be assembled in vertical position arrow points upwards 230V 50 60 Hz Connection via a contactor to one phase 230 V motors with a power input of more than 1 1 kW Direct connection to one phase 230 V motors with a maximum power input of 1 1 kW
5. rd start up pressure between min 1 5 bar and max 2 bar INSTALLATION fig 1 and 2 Attention Before installation ensure that the technical characteristics of the device the pump and the unit are compatible The pressure of then pump must amount to minimum 3 5 bar 0 35 MPa and maximum 8 bar 0 8 MPa The water column between the device and the highest extraction point must not exceed 15 m If the pressure of the pump does not reach the above mentioned values the pump blocks or does not switch off The pump starts but does not switch on or it does not switch off if the height of the water column exceeds the above mentioned values In order to eliminate this disturbance install the device at a higher position The device may be directly installed onto the pump or between the pump and the first extraction point fig 1 Install a pressure reducer between the pump and the device if the inlet pressure at the device exceeds 8 bar 0 8 MPa No extraction point must be installed between the pump and the device fig 1 The device must be installed in such a manner that the arrows indicating the flow direction point upwards fig 1 A It is recommended to install a ball valve and a manometer at the outlet of the device in order to check the functionality of the pump and the device when they are separated from the unit using the valve and in order to determine the actual discharge height of the pump using the manometer The output of the device
